Now, I know a bit about the history of broadgate, and that it used to
be a mainline station called broad street, and assumed that these might
be the old lift shafts for the broad street entrance to liverpool
street central line tube station, since they seem to be close to above
where the bridge runs over the west end of the eastbound platform.


I believe they are associated with the Central Line substation, the cables
to/from which use an old Broad Street escalator shaft. Whether they
correspond to the old lift-shafts I wouldn't like to say.
